TM4C129EKCPDT: Static protection

Part Number: TM4C129EKCPDT

Hi,

We recently switched our product design from Stalles MCU (LM3S9B90)) to Tiva MCU (TM4C129EKCPDT).  It looks like the Tiva MCU is more susceptible to static damage. We don't use multi-layer PCB design to save cost, and we are aware that this leads to less static protection on MCUs.

With the similar static condition , the Stalles board normally experiences a reset, but the Tiva board is likely to have the MCU damaged. 

The static condition is made with the following procedure: 1. rubbing my body with an office chair; 2.immediately touch the edge of the board. The edge of the board is the standard static guard design (an open rim trace with a 1M resistor connecting to the circuit ground).

Is any information I can refer to to improve static protection?
